Trends in Computing: Why Staying Updated with Computing Trends Matters
The world is becoming increasingly digital, industries demand professionals who can adapt to evolving computing advancements. Companies leverage AI-driven automation, cybersecurity measures, and data-driven strategies to gain an edge amid their competitors. Mastering Current Trends in Computing enables students to secure high-paying jobs and solve complex real-world problems with efficiency.
For instance, major corporations like Google and Amazon continuously integrate AI and Big Data Analytics to optimize their operations. Cybersecurity attacks, such as the infamous SolarWinds breach, highlight the need for robust security measures. Moreover, industries from healthcare to finance are implementing Quantum Computing to solve problems that classical computers cannot handle efficiently.

Quantum Computing
Quantum Computing is poised to revolutionize cryptography, AI, and problem-solving. KRCT prepares students for this frontier with:
- Quantum Algorithms – Exploring Shor’s and Grover’s algorithms, critical for breaking encryption and speeding up search operations.
- Quantum Cryptography – Studying encryption techniques that are nearly impossible to breach, already being researched by Google and IBM.
- Qubits & Superposition – Understanding how quantum states accelerate complex computations, used in optimizing logistics and pharmaceutical research.
